LOCATING A LOST DEVICE
20170374515 · 2017-12-28 ·

An embodiment of the invention may include a method, computer program product and computer system for detecting a device. The embodiment may include a computing device that determines a Universally Unique Identifier (UUID) of a beacon of a second device. The computing device may determine a first location of the first device. The computing device may determine whether the UUID of the beacon of the second device matches a UUID in a list of UUIDs, where each UUID in the list of UUIDs corresponds to a beacon associated with a device. The computing device may transmitting the UUID of the beacon of the second device and the first location to a third device, based on determining the UUID of the beacon of the second device matches an entry in the list.

Validating radio frequency identification (RFID) alarm event tags

An RFID portal of an EAS system first interrogates a first zone extending into a controlled area beyond a threshold distance from an interrogating antenna of the portal. The portal defines an exit from the controlled area, the threshold distance being less than a width of the exit. The portal first detects, in response to the first interrogating, a first response of a particular RFID tag. The portal second interrogate, subsequent to the first detecting, in a second zone extending into the controlled area at least to the threshold distance. The portal second detects, in response to the second interrogating, at least one second response of the particular RFID tag indicating a received signal strength of the second interrogating at the particular RFID tag corresponding to a distance from an interrogating antenna of the portal less than the threshold distance. The EAS system alarms in response to the second detecting.

Smart home system with firearm tracking
11674768 · 2023-06-13 · ·

A smart home system with firearm tracking includes a sensor network installed within a building and a control panel including an input mechanism, a display screen, a wireless transceiver, and a scanning mechanism. The system is configured to monitor at least one firearm that has an ammunition sensor, a GPS sensor, a wireless transceiver, and a magazine having a unique scannable QR code. The control panel receives user identification information via the input mechanism or an external remote device, generates a user profile that includes the identification information, scans the unique QR code of the firearm magazine, assigns the magazine to a selected user profile, and receives an ammunition count from the firearm as detected by the ammunition sensor. The system can send location and ammunition change notifications to the control panel display, external user devices, and emergency authorities to enhance the safety of the firearm user and general public.
